Laurel-oil content — a traditional range, not a certified grade
Laurel-oil content in Aleppo soap typically runs from around 2% up to 30–40% depending on the producer, and no official standard sets those tiers — it's a customary range, not a regulated grade. Cosmetic labelling and NPN — what applies here
Soap and oils sold into Canada are cosmetics, not drugs — Health Canada's Cosmetic Regulations require notification within 10 days of first sale and an INCI ingredient list on the outer label (Food and Drugs Act, Cosmetic Regulations, C.R.C. c.869). Whether a specific product needs a Natural Health Product number instead depends entirely on the claims made on its label, not on the ingredient itself — our answer on when natural oils need an NPN walks through that distinction, and our note on laurel percentage and skin type is a useful companion for shop staff fielding customer questions in the same cosmetic-only register.
Buying questions, answered
Are these products sold as cosmetics or drugs?
Cosmetics only. All copy and signage should stay in cosmetic, traditional-use language — no claim that a product treats or cures a condition.
What's the laurel-oil percentage in the soap?
It varies by producer, typically from around 2% up to 30–40%, with no official standard setting the tiers. Ask for the specific bar's stated percentage on your quotation rather than assuming a figure.
Do these products need an NPN?
It depends on the claims made on the label, not the product itself — see our linked answer on Natural Health Product licensing for the distinction.
